so after only ever seeing a rbv in my yard i deiced to work on something a bit different.. i own a 2wd slammed yellow ranger, a lifted black ranger an a 88 b2 tuff truck.. they have all been custom built an its been a great experience i needed a new project... well my pop owns a 93 4x4 ranger, a 93 4x4 explorer 2 door an just picked up a 85 b2 to turn into a tuff truck.. well i decided to build up the explorer.. i said hell. no one in this area has one . all my friends are mostly ranger owners, we all have a lifted ranger, a lifted explorer is gonna look sweet...

it was bought back in 00 with 40k on it. fully loaded.. 235s 3.27s a4ld well since hes owned it nothing has really been touched on it so the maintenance department has been a little weak. It now has 84k. Hes one of those guys, if its not broke dont fix it.. so i started gathering components to lift it. i picked up some 4inch pivot brackets from another member on here took the 4inch r/c coils an rad drop brackets out of my black truck ,got some 4inch lift shocks from my buddy who sold his f150 and bought a new rear axle from another member over at rps that came out of a newer explorer. 3.73s ls disc.
then i was searching craigslist an picked up some 33.12.50.15 procomp tires and black cragar wheels for 100 bucks.. 3 of the tires are in great shape an ones bald. but for 100 bucks how can you go wrong..








well as you know once you start to tear into something you find other problems that need to be addressed.. so after getting the axle mocked up an the spring perches re welded to a spring over position i needed to bolt up the sway bar an shocks.. well sway bar was too short an the stock shocks were too long.. so i cut off the sway bar an bolted the shocks to the top of the sway bar mounts . worked out great! then i had to i had to work on making new leaf spring mounts.. i made new shackles 3 years ago for it an apparently you cant buy left spring mounts from ford any more. so i had some chunks of 2x6 1/4 wall box tubing that i used an cut out some mounts..




inorder to bolt up the new mounts the gas tank needed to be dropped. so what else do i see wrong.. gas tank straps are rotted. get gas tank dropped build some new straps out of 2x 1/8th flat bar an get everything back in place. get new axle bolted up calipers bled drive shaft hooked up an i start it up an i smell fuel.. well fuel lines at the sending unit were DESTROYED.

so down to the parts store i go an order a new one for 100 bucks..



came back an started tackling the front, went fairly easy considering its been apart not too long ago, get the new brackets an everything bolted up noticed the driver brake line looked pretty gimppy, no biggy i had a new one for it in a bag that was never put on.. once you change a brake line what needs to be done? brake bleeding.. the bleeder valves on the calpers were Non existing so off to the parts store i go an order up some new ones.. now ive got great brakes! i decided to tackle the exhaust an get rid of the leaks.. cat flange muffler flange took the torch an grinder cut cat off punched out the flange bolts. got some new bolts an muffler putty an no more leaks! noticed a little leak look at the collectors an yeah.. the flanges are just about non existing so i kinda "dont" remember seeing them haha. after that was finished had one last thing to do was replace the speedo gear.. its a bad thing when the housing falls apart before you get it out of the vehicle.. luckly a friend had a spare..




take it down the road it its got a bit of bump steer. i think this will get fixed once i get a drop pitman arm for it an i also noticed a vibration at about 25 miles an hour:annoyed:.. once you hit about 32 it goes away. change the front rear shaft u joint an it helped a little but its still there.. all in all theirs still a few more kinks to work out.. has a 2inch rake with a 6inch lift out back from doing a spring over conversion an the front is at 4inches. not too bad for a weekend :icon_thumby:
